Max. Working Thickness | 100 mm | |
Working Length | 100 mm and over | |
Feed System | Chain track | |
Feed Drive Motor | 3 hp (5 hp optional) | |
Feed Speed | 5–25 m/min | Variable feed means you can match speed to material and profile without changing tooling or setup. |
Distance Between Dogs | 400 mm (300 / 200 mm optional, or without dogs) | Dog spacing determines the minimum repeat length in a batch run — confirm your typical panel lengths before specifying this option. |
Moulding Unit 1 — Motor | 7.5 hp (10 hp optional) | |
Moulding Unit 1 — Spindle Speed | 4,500–8,000 rpm (10,000 rpm optional) | |
Moulding Unit 1 — Jumping Function | Yes (standard) | The jumping function allows the spindle to lift clear of the workpiece at the start and end of a pass, reducing breakout on the leading and trailing edges. |
Moulding Unit 1 — Spindle Diameter | 40 mm | |
Moulding Unit 1 — Cutter Diameter | 190–250 mm | |
Moulding Unit 2 — Motor | 10 hp | |
Moulding Unit 2 — Spindle Speed | 4,500–6,000 rpm (10,000 rpm optional) | |
Moulding Unit 2 — Spindle Diameter | 40 mm | |
Moulding Unit 2 — Cutter Diameter | 190–250 mm | |
Profile Sanding Unit — Motors | 3 hp × 3 units | |
Profile Sanding Unit — Spindle Speed | 0–1,800 rpm | |
Optional HSK Spindle System | Available | HSK tooling allows faster cutter changes between jobs — worth specifying if you run frequent profile changeovers. |
Net Weight | 4,250 kg | Floor loading must be verified before installation at this weight. |
Gross Weight (packed) | 4,600 kg | |
Machine Dimensions (L×W×H) | 4,110 × 1,620 × 1,900 mm | Allow additional clearance at both in-feed and out-feed ends for your longest workpieces, plus extraction ducting on both moulding units. |
Packing Dimensions (L×W×H) | 4,230 × 1,600 × 2,120 mm | |
